Senior Research Associate to design, execute and manage research projects in Cancer Immunology and Immunotherapy in the laboratory of Dr. Mark P. Rubinstein as directed in the OSUCCC Pelotonia Institute for Immuno-Oncology (PIIO) in the Comprehensive Cancer Center.

The Rubinstein laboratory is focused on basic and translational approaches for the immune-based therapies for cancer and other human disease. Ongoing efforts include understanding why immunotherapy works in some patients and fails other patients. Furthermore, ongoing efforts include the development of novel therapeutics to overcome resistance mechanisms limiting current therapeutic approaches. The successful candidate will have a strong interest in contributing to these efforts and also training students and junior laboratory staff. Furthermore, the successful candidate can help lead collection of samples from the clinic. If these interests align with your goals, please include this in your cover letter.   • collaborates with principal investigator (PI) to develop and implement goals and objectives of studies

  • conceptualizes, designs and executes complex laboratory experiments

  • plans and executes advanced molecular and cellular techniques using advanced genetic and immunological technologies to aid the development of immune-based strategies for the treatment of cancer, including single cell sequencing, high dimensional imaging, cloning, molecular biology, immunohistochemistry, Western blot, tissue culture, PCR and flow cytometry

  • collect, sort, and process tissue and blood samples from cancer patients

  • records and consolidates research data

  • collaborates with principal investigator to write and prepare research papers and manuscripts for publication and presentation at national and conferences and workshops, and in the writing of project reports, articles and other document

  • research current scientific literature on specified topics

  • oversee instruction of research assistants, undergraduate, and graduate students in laboratory procedures and operation of equipment

  • calibrate various laboratory equipment and operate microscopes, centrifuges and other laboratory equipment


Education/Experience:

  • Master's degree in an appropriate biological/health science or an equivalent combination of education and experience is required, Doctoral degree preferred.

  • Requires 4 years of relevant experience in a biological/health research capacity, 5+ years preferred.

  • Knowledge of genetic and immunological technologies, single cell sequencing, high dimensional imaging, cloning, molecular biology, immunohistochemistry, Western blot, tissue culture, PCR and flow cytometry highly desired.
